This was a unique show for Where Did the Road Go? There was no guest, just your main host Seriah, and his co-host Luke St. Clair. They discuss Seriah's experiences with spontaneous Kundalini awakening as well as electrical effects he suffered for many years afterwards. Kundalini, known more for it's style of Yoga is a powerful force. When awakened spontaneously, there is no control, and one may literally lose their mind. After searching for a guest to discuss these experiences with, Seriah, with the help of Luke, decided to do this himself. Seriah did talk about this with Micah Hanks back at the end of 2013 on The Gralien Report, but this goes more in depth. Beyond that, the conversation goes into some related experiences.
